      <description>&lt;P&gt;For a person like this, you need to come over as quite definite and organised. Polite still, but sure of yourself. You need to project that confidence to the buyer, don't be wishy washy as in 'I can't see any other purchases from you' or 'I don't know what else you could have bought'.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Be definite.&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;"You have only ever purchased one item from me. It is XYZ, which you bought on x/x/2024."&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Then go on to outline how they may have placed items in their cart without a purchase actually going through so they need to check that as you can't see unpurchased items in people's carts.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Tell them to check their purchase history as the other option is they may have bought some items from another seller but if so, it will show there.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I think it is extremely important you answer the query, to head off trouble if you can. I know you already have, but &lt;EM&gt;keep replying&lt;/EM&gt; to any fresh messages so she knows you are still engaged.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Plus I also worried about possible feedback. A lot would depend on the wording of any neg as to whether it could be removed or not.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
